Security protection computer monitoring operation platform
Technical Field
The utility model relates to the technical field of operation platforms, in particular to a security computer monitoring operation platform.
Background
The monitoring operation platform is an important component part of internal configuration of a control center, a monitoring center, a command management center and the like. Various monitoring pictures are arranged in a common monitoring room, and the pictures are generally controlled through an operation platform.
The operation platform is generally a keyboard to control the picture or call the picture, some keyboards are directly amplified on the platform, so that ash is easy to fall off, some keyboards can be taken out through sliding in the platform, and when the keyboards are taken out, people who sit well generally need to retreat a little, so that the keyboards are not blocked, the operation is troublesome, and when people do approach the platform, the keyboards need to retreat every time the people take the keyboards, so that inconvenience is brought.
Disclosure of Invention
The utility model aims to provide a security computer monitoring operation platform which can be conveniently displayed by a keyboard and does not contain dust.

Detailed Description
Reference will now be made in detail to the present embodiments of the present utility model, examples of which are illustrated in the accompanying drawings, wherein the accompanying drawings are used to supplement the description of the written description so that one can intuitively and intuitively understand each technical feature and overall technical scheme of the present utility model, but not to limit the scope of the present utility model.
Referring to fig. 1-4, a security computer monitoring operation platform according to an embodiment of the present utility model includes: the operation table body 1, the computer host is arranged in the operation table body 1, the screen 2 is arranged on the front wall of the operation table body 1, the security monitoring picture can be displayed in the operation table body, the control key 11 can be placed in the operation table body 1, the second groove 10 is arranged on the upper surface of the control table 8, the support column 5 is fixedly connected with the inner bottom wall of the second groove 10, when the rotating plate 9 is horizontally arranged in the second groove 10, the rotating plate 9 can be supported by the support column 5, the control key 11 is arranged in the first groove 3, the height of the control key 11 is lower than the height of the support column 5, the control key 11 is placed in the second groove 10, the picture in the screen 2 can be controlled by the control key 11, the picture size can be adjusted, and the like, the third groove 15 is arranged on the front wall of the second groove 10, the inside fixedly connected with motor 13 of third recess 15, when motor 13 starts, just can drive rotation post 18 and rotate, thereby can let rotation board 9 rotate, can increase a controller on operation panel body 1, come the start of control motor 13 through the controller, the output fixedly connected with rotation post 18 of motor 13, the outer wall fixedly connected with rotation board 9 of rotation post 18, the quantity of support column 5 is two, rotation board 9 sets up on support column 5, when installing rotation board 9, can control the height of rotation board 9, can keep its level with the plane of control panel 8 when rotation board 9 level, then support column 5 can support the lower surface of rotation board 9, one side that rotation board 9 is close to movable board 14 and movable board 14 just in time laminate, the clearance between is very little, thus control panel 8, rotation board 9 and movable board 14 three's top is on the coplanar.
The sliding groove 19 is formed in the front wall and the rear wall of the second groove 10, the sliding block 17 is connected to the inner portion of the sliding groove 19 in a sliding mode, the moving plate 14 is fixedly connected to the upper surface of the sliding block 17, the spring 16 is fixedly connected to the inner bottom wall of the second groove 10, the top end of the spring 16 is fixedly connected with the bottom wall of the sliding block 17, two ends of the sliding block 17 are arranged in the sliding groove 19, the length of the moving plate 14 is identical to the width of the second groove 10, the moving plate 14 can be tightly attached to the console 8, when the rotating plate 9 is pressed onto the moving plate 14, the moving plate 14 can be pressed by hands, the spring 16 can be gradually compressed, therefore, the moving plate 14 can gradually move downwards, and when the rotating plate 9 is moved away, the moving plate 14 can move to the top end.
The front wall of the operation desk body 1 and be located screen 2 downside and be provided with first recess 3, the last fixed surface of operation desk body 1 is connected with two risers 7, rotates between two risers 7 and is connected with protection roller 6, and protection roller 6's one end sets up in first recess 3, and after personnel left, can rotate protection roller 6, lets the roller cloth expand gradually, and the one end of cloth has the couple, can hang in first recess 3, can prevent that the dust from falling on the screen 2.
The front wall of the console body 1 is hinged with the door 4 at the lower side of the console 8, and some devices and wires can be stored in the console body, so that when maintenance is needed, the internal devices can be maintained by opening the door 4.
The sliding plate 12 is fixedly connected to the lower surface of the moving plate 14 and located on one side of the spring 16, the sliding plate 12 is slidably connected with the console 8, the sliding plate 12 can slide with the console 8, and the sliding plate 12 can prevent dust from entering the console 8 through the side of the console 8.
Working principle: the motor 13 is started to rotate the rotating column 18, the rotating plate 9 on the rotating column 18 is gradually rotated from the horizontal direction, so that the rotating plate 9 is gradually pressed on the moving plate 14, the moving plate 14 is gradually moved downwards, finally, the rotating plate 9 is completely horizontally pressed on the moving plate 14, the control keys 11 are exposed, the content in the screen 2 can be controlled, and then the protective roller 6 is closed, so that the screen 2 can be seen.
